Dr. Negiel Bigpond is a full blood Euchee/Yuchi Native American whose family was on the Trail of Tears.
His Yuchi name is Au was day, which means Sky Hunter, One Who Seeks Vision.
Dr. Bigpond is a fourth generation minister of the gospel. He and wife, of 41 years, Jan have been blessed with three children, two sons-in-law, one daughter-in-law, and six wonderful grandchildren.
Having been in ministry for over 30 years as both an evangelist and a pastor, Dr. Bigpond has been fortunate enough to share the gospel with the people of over 200 Native American/First Nation reservations. He is currently serving as Apostle of Morning Star Church of All Nations and gives apostolic oversight to other churches on and off reservations in America.
Dr. Bigpond is a certified drug and alcohol abuse counselor; as well as, an accomplished musician and singer.
Dr. Bigpond played an active role in the development of a joint resolution of apology to Native peoples for ill-conceived policies by the U.S. government regarding Indian Tribes; frequently traveling to Washington D.C. to work with Senator Sam Brownback (Ret.) of Kansas.
In light of his tireless work with the resolution, Charisma Magazine named Dr. Bigpond one of the Ten Most Influential Christian Leaders of 2006. His works include his involvement with Native America Justice Gate East of the Mississippi; which deals with land reconciliation in the eastern states. I grew up in Santa Fe, New Mexico. I have over 50 years’ experience with Peace Officers & National Security. From about age 12, I was associated with Santa Fe County deputies, posse, and reservists, under Sheriffs Roybal, Escudero, and Garcia. This was from the mid 1960s until 1973 when I joined the US Army.
In the US Army I was issued FBI Top Secret Clearance for my computer science duties. I was honorably discharged from active-duty June 1976 and continued in the Reserves until 1979. I was issued my first Federal Badge in 1978 at the Los Alamos National Laboratory (LANL) where I worked from 1978 through 1996. I was called back to LANL in 2010 and worked at the Training Center until I retired in 2013.
